Output 7943f26c66fdc5d0c8f318825399e2d53d0735e128ecdfbe00f0e795a58a82f8:7

value
1399876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8664eceb6c1c1177374a8b09423db530009483 OP_EQUAL
address
3AQ77eFoz4yYLUzYUPREiMRZgn9Vvt8W8c
transaction
7943f26c66fdc5d0c8f318825399e2d53d0735e128ecdfbe00f0e795a58a82f8
spent
true